Job Description

Quality Engineer Henderson, WV 25106 $69,966.30 - $84,260.48 a year - Full-time $69,966.30 - $84,260.48 a year - Full-time A unique injection molder with the ability to mold both thermoset and thermoplastic compounds is seeking an experienced Quality Engineer. This company works with clients to design and engineer products for customers in the automotive, medical, electrical, hand tool, and communications industries. Utilizing a modern automated assembly process, they provide customers with a superior product at a competitive price.
Qualifications:
Minimum A.S. in Quality Management, Engineering, or technical field preferred; High School Diploma or GED required 4-5 years of experience in quality within a manufacturing setting 4-5 years of experience in a leadership role Experience in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ing (GD&T) Proficiency with both manual and computerized measuring equipment/systems
Key Responsibilities:
Function as internal lead auditor for the Quality Management System (QMS), ISO 9001 and other certifications by: Maintaining lead auditor certification Planning, scheduling audits and training the internal audit team Following up with functional departments to ensure all findings are communicated, understood, and addressed in a timely and complete manner Scheduling, coordinating and leading external 3rd party audits to maintain certifications Provide quality leadership for all quality items in the Product Lifecycle Management and stage-gating process, and quality support and training for other departments and suppliers.
Key activities include:
Developing DFMEA, DVP&R, process flow diagrams, and PFMEA to identify and plan mitigation of risks Identification of critical-to-quality characteristics within products and product families Control Plans, test plans, gaging requirements, gage design/build Developing and completing documentation including quality plans, quality standards, gaging, measurement and test instructions, and reporting methods Supervise other quality department employees as assigned Lead or assist in problem solving investigations, DOEs, gage and capability studies In conjunction with the process engineer, investigate and recommend new measuring, testing, inspection, error proofing and best practices to improve quality, product yield and productivity Submit daily, weekly, and monthly reports on process performance as required Perform other duties as assigned
